What is the pineal gland?
The pineal gland, also called as pineal body or epiphysis, is situated centrally in the head. It secretes the hormone melatonin, a hormone formed at night and related to the regulation of the circadian rhythm (or circadian cycle, the wakefulness-sleep cycle). Melatonin possibly regulates many body functions related to the night-day alternation.
